Thank you for your interest in Burt's Bees. The Director of Scientific

development has put together a list of products that are "restricted" and

should be avoided by Celiac and Gluten patients.



For Celiac Patients - Gluten Restricted:



Products Containing Wheat, Oat, Rye & Barley Derived Ingredients



Please AVOID these products:



Baby Bee Apricot Baby Oil

Dr. Burt's Rescue Ointment (Comfrey Salve)

Carrot Day Crème

Carrot Night Crème

Vitamin E Bath & Body Oil

Avocado Hair Treatment

Coconut Foot Crème

Orange Essence Cleansing Crème

Bay Rum Aftershave Balm

Baby Bee Buttermilk Soap

Poison Ivy Soap

Rosemary Mint Shampoo Bar

Citrus Facial Scrub

Baby Bee Shampoo Bar



I hope this is helpful information. Our kit contents change often, so you

will have to go over each product in your particular kit and match it

against this list of products to avoid. I have attached a list of products

that you can use. Thank you for your e-mail!
